Apply What You've Learned


Demonstrate Word Knowledge Answer the questions. 1 What kind of misfortune has a friend experienced? __________________________________________________________________________________


Answers will vary. Jason broke his arm while climbing a tree.


2 Has your bedroom ever looked as if a siege had taken place? __________________________________________________________________________________


Yes. After I had two friends sleep over, it was a real mess.


3 When was a time when you were very determined? __________________________________________________________________________________


I really wanted to make the basketball team, so I practiced for many hours.


4 When have you ever been desperate for some water? __________________________________________________________________________________


The last time I ate a lot of salty pretzels, I needed water very badly.


5 Would you be astonished if a clown jumped out of a big cake? __________________________________________________________________________________


Not really; I’ve seen tricks like this before.


6 How could you conserve your energy if you got lost outdoors? __________________________________________________________________________________


I could leave markers on my trail, so I wouldn’t end up walking in circles.


7 What would you do if an army of ants invaded your picnic? __________________________________________________________________________________


I would move the picnic to another spot.


8 If you were afraid of snakes, how could you conquer that fear? __________________________________________________________________________________


I could read about snakes to learn which ones are dangerous.


9 How would you reassure a young child who had a scary dream? __________________________________________________________________________________


I would talk in a quiet voice and tell him or her that the dream wasn’t real.


10 When have you assumed something but were wrong? __________________________________________________________________________________


I thought I wasn’t invited to my friend’s party. Then I found out that she had mailed the invitation to the wrong address.
